Don’t miss the Arizona Game and Fish Department’s 2023 Outdoor Expo on March 25-26! It’s a great place to learn about Arizona’s more than 800 species of wildlife and the science-based methods used to conserve and protect them all. 

Earnhardt Auto Centers collaborates with Arizona Game and Fish to promote their monthly podcast, Wild About Arizona, featuring different information about local wildlife. The outdoor Expo is your chance to experience all this wildlife first-hand!

Photo courtesy of Arizona Game and Fish Department

This event will feature everything from animal exhibits and family fishing tanks to trying out firearms in a safe, controlled environment. Also, with displays on off-highway vehicles (OHVs), wildlife watching, archery and more, you might just find a new hobby! Outdoor recreation and conservation groups, government agencies and commercial vendors of outdoor products and services will also participate in the Expo. 

It all happens at the Ben Avery Shooting Facility in Phoenix, located on Carefree Highway about a half mile west of I-17.

Earnhardt Auto Centers represents 15 brands at 17 dealerships throughout the Valley. Founder Tex Earnhardt started the company in 1951 with a Chandler-based Ford franchise and was the youngest-ever Ford franchise owner. Over the years, the company expanded and opened more dealerships and affiliates, with Tex at the head. Tex’s straight-shooting style and famous catchphrase, “That ain’t no bull,” endeared him to generations of Arizonans.
